Friends with Freshmen!


Classes have just started but freshmen have already met the people they will be friends with for the next 4-5 years of their college careers.

Due to the Hurricane, Kean University postponed move-ins til Monday, August 29th. But that didn't change any other activities for the week! Tuesday, the freshmen were oriented to "all things Kean", including Kean cru! Many colleges believe that freshmen need to learn how to survive college, but we believe they also need to be equipped to thrive in life. At a club awareness fair, I was able to set up a table and hand out "freshmen survival kits" (Bibles, water bottles, fliers & "Jesus Without Religion" books by Rick James) to over 100 new freshmen! Within an hour of the first group of freshmen, we had given nearly everything away. And the only reason I believe we still had Bibles was because we had extra donated by a local church.

Answered prayer: KU Cru men leaders! Joe, Harvey, Karl, Jon, Joe
Before anything else happened, I met with all the Kean cru leaders (men pictured right) to divide the 115 surveys so that we could each follow them up. On a survey from 1-10, nearly 30 students marked a 10 to answer the question "rate your desire to know God personally"! Tuesday night, after the fair, students were invited to meet in front of a freshmen residence hall to go out for a photo scavenger hunt! Wednesday, our Kean cru student leaders met over lunch to follow up with more surveys! Thursday, they were all invited to our "meet & greet" in the New Freshmen Residence Hall. About 10 students who attended were freshmen who desired to strengthen their walk with Jesus! Praise the Lord!

Three of these freshmen stated in their intros that they went on mission trips this summer with their churches! I have a great feeling that this year we will see strong freshmen believers sent as missionaries from their local churches to our college campus to share Christ and help transform lives through the power of the Holy Spirit!
